The finer points of DK UI and ekeing out performance are basically just resource management/awareness. You can see my runes are dead center with my RP right next to it. Important CDs I have weak auras for directly below that, and it's all in line with the blizz proc UI making a nice little square around my toon. You don't have to do it like that obviously, but the principles are the same - the information you need to react to quickly, needs to be in your direct vision, not your peripheral. Blood Tap charges are in numerical form directly above that too, top left of my Target of Target.
Aside from setting up your UI, it's just a matter of getting used to what is important and when. AMS soaking and stuff for instance, treat it like a dps cooldown. I've modified some of what I track a bit since then. Diseases are to the right, more important as Unholy than as Frost.
The real trick is once you know which aspects you're not as good at tracking, those are the things you can emphasize on your UI. Example: I'm AWFUL at blood plague when I'm frost (at least obliterate frost, masterfrost it's a lot simpler), so I have an extra aura that screams at me when it falls off.
Soul Reaper is usually another trouble point, I had to make 6 seperate weak auras to track it correctly for all specs, but it's worth it - it's a HUGE part of your dps (especially as unholy) and it's a pain in the dick to use it well if you don't have something like that.
